The diagnostic sequence determines everything in Byram Center. EZ Open performs the manual release test first on every won't-open call in Byram Center, NJ. The emergency release cord is pulled to disconnect the door from the opener trolley in Byram Center. The door is manually lifted in Byram Center, NJ. If the door lifts easily and holds its position, the opener is the source of the problem in Byram Center. If the door is very heavy or won't hold a raised position, the spring has failed and the opener symptom is a consequence of the spring failure in Byram Center, NJ. If the door won't move at all manually, the door is physically stuck from a cable failure, track obstruction, or off-track condition in Byram Center. Three completely different repair paths determined by a thirty-second test in Byram Center, NJ. This test is why EZ Open doesn't replace the opener when the spring is the problem in Byram Center.

A broken torsion spring removes the counterbalancing force that makes the door movable by the opener in Byram Center, NJ. The opener provides 10 to 20 pounds of net lifting force against a counterbalanced door in Byram Center. Without spring counterbalancing, the opener is trying to lift 150 to 400 pounds with 10 to 20 pounds of force in Byram Center, NJ. The manual release test reveals a heavy door that won't hold its position in Byram Center. A visible gap in the torsion spring coil confirms the break in Byram Center, NJ.
A broken cable allows one side of the door to drop, tilting the door in the track in Byram Center. The tilted door is physically jammed against the track walls and can't travel in either direction in Byram Center, NJ. The manual release test reveals a door that won't move at all in Byram Center. Inspection finds a loose cable at the bottom corner of the lower side in Byram Center, NJ. Cable replacement and spring assessment are required in Byram Center.
A failed opener component prevents the opener from producing the force needed to move the door in Byram Center. The manual release test reveals a door that lifts easily and holds its position in Byram Center, NJ. The door hardware is functioning correctly in Byram Center. The opener is the source of the symptom in Byram Center, NJ. Component assessment identifies the specific failed component in Byram Center.
The emergency release cord disconnects the trolley carriage from the trolley in Byram Center. If the carriage was disconnected and not reconnected, the opener runs the trolley along the rail while the carriage and door sit stationary in Byram Center, NJ. The door appears completely unopened and unresponsive in Byram Center. The manual release test reveals a door that lifts easily because the carriage is already disconnected in Byram Center, NJ. Reconnecting the carriage to the trolley resolves the symptom immediately in Byram Center. No component is damaged or failed in Byram Center, NJ.
A door that has come off its track has a roller outside the track channel creating a physical blockage in Byram Center, NJ. The door can't travel in either direction through the blockage in Byram Center. The manual release test reveals a door that won't move at all in Byram Center, NJ. Visual inspection finds the roller or rollers outside the track channel in Byram Center. Off-track repair with cause identification is required before the door can open correctly in Byram Center, NJ.
A dead remote battery produces a door that doesn't respond to the remote in Byram Center, NJ. The wall button will operate the door normally in Byram Center. If the door opens with the wall button but not the remote, replace the remote battery before calling for service in Byram Center, NJ. A new battery resolves this in approximately two minutes in Byram Center. If the door doesn't respond to either the remote or the wall button,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and a service call is warranted in Byram Center, NJ.
In cold climates, water from condensation or melting snow freezes at the contact point between the door's bottom seal and the garage floor overnight in Byram Center. The frozen bond holds the door to the floor despite the opener providing its normal lifting force in Byram Center, NJ. The manual release test typically reveals a door that's very difficult to lift manually as the ice bond resists upward force in Byram Center. Gentle heat application at the floor seal breaks the ice bond in most cases in Byram Center, NJ. Do not run the opener repeatedly against a frozen door in Byram Center.
An object in the track, debris accumulation at a specific point, or a bent track section narrows the channel below the roller diameter in Byram Center. The door opens to the obstruction point and stops in Byram Center, NJ. The manual release test may show the door lifting partially and then stopping at the obstruction in Byram Center. Track clearing or track repair is required to restore full travel in Byram Center, NJ.
Before any other action, try the wall button inside the garage in Byram Center, NJ. If the wall button opens the door, the problem is with the remote rather than the door or opener in Byram Center. Replace the remote battery first in Byram Center, NJ. If the wall button also produces no response,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and EZ Open's service is needed in Byram Center.
Look at the opener trolley and the carriage bracket that connects to the door in Byram Center. If the carriage hook is hanging freely rather than engaged in the trolley, the emergency release was pulled and not reconnected in Byram Center, NJ. Pull the red emergency release cord toward the door to re-engage the carriage in Byram Center. If the door then opens with the opener, no repair was needed in Byram Center, NJ.
Look at the torsion spring on the shaft above the door opening in Byram Center, NJ. A broken spring has a visible gap in the otherwise continuous coil where the wire separated in Byram Center. If a gap is visible, do not attempt to open the door in Byram Center, NJ. Call EZ Open for same-day broken spring repair in Byram Center.
Running the opener repeatedly against a door that won't open risks stripping the drive gear in Byram Center. Manually pulling a door that's jammed from a cable failure or off-track condition can damage the panel at the force application point in Byram Center, NJ. Forcing a door with a broken cable can release the door suddenly in Byram Center. The cost of the forced damage adds to whatever the original repair cost would have been in Byram Center, NJ.
If you must access the garage before EZ Open arrives in Byram Center, NJ, use the external keyed emergency release if your door has one in Byram Center. If not, use the manual release cord carefully with at least one other person present in Byram Center, NJ. With a broken spring, the door is very heavy and will not hold a raised position in Byram Center. Lift only the minimum amount required and do not stand under the door in Byram Center, NJ.
